Roll Over or Transfer Funds
Generally, you can roll over or transfer funds from another Keogh or qualified retirement plan, 403(b) plan, government 457(b) or conduit IRA, to a Keogh with TIAA-CREF. Please consult your tax advisor or legal counsel regarding any potential tax considerations involved.
Before rolling over or transferring funds from another Keogh to one with TIAA-CREF, consider how a rollover differs from a transfer, and then decide which is more to your advantage. Also, if you are considering terminating an existing plan, you might want to think about whether you should move your Keogh assets to another Keogh or to an IRA. Finally, review the provisions of your current Keogh plan to see how they may affect the rollover or transfer.
